Calling to Ministry: In their youth, Gregory and Heidi gained hearts for Gospel work in areas of the world where the Church is small and the socioeconomic situation is poor. In their early 20s before marriage, they both served with various missional groups in a few countries. They came together over a shared call to global missions. After marriage, they initially worked in an inner city context in the USA. As they sought how the Lord would have them love the church and the poor, He led Heidi to medical school and Gregory to seminary. Gregory also served on a church staff team helping the church walk with the poor. She became a pediatrician and he became an Anglican priest. They moved to Cambodia in 2013, where Heidi trains Cambodian Christian resident physicians at a hospital, and Gregory works in the Anglican Church of Cambodia pastoring a congregation and pioneering other missional work in partnership with the church.
Vision for Ministry: Gregory and Heidi hope to see the Anglican Church of Cambodia continue to grow and expand and eventually develop into a diocese with churches, education, and work among the poor. They aim to see Cambodian Christian physicians growing in their practice of medicine, in their faith, and in being missional in their contexts.
